The Art of Nymph Fishing: Techniques for Success

Posted on By

Nymph fishing is one of the most consistent and technically rewarding ways to catch trout, grayling, and other river fish, because it targets the stage of aquatic insects that fish eat most often: the underwater nymph. In practical terms, nymphing means presenting an imitation below the surface at the depth and speed where fish are feeding, then detecting often subtle takes before the fish rejects the fly. As a hub topic within techniques and strategies, nymphing deserves careful treatment because success depends on a blend of entomology, rig design, casting control, drift management, strike detection, and river reading. I have spent many seasons guiding and fishing nymphs on freestone streams, tailwaters, and spring creeks, and the pattern is always the same: anglers who understand depth, contact, and drift catch far more fish than anglers who simply tie on a fly and hope.

The term nymph covers immature aquatic insects such as mayflies, stoneflies, and caddis larvae or pupae, along with other subsurface foods like sowbugs, scuds, worms, and midge larvae. Because trout feed underwater for most of the year, nymph fishing often outperforms dry-fly fishing, especially in cold water, high sun, fast currents, and pressured conditions. It matters to beginners because it raises catch rates quickly, and it matters to advanced anglers because the smallest refinements in angle, weight, leader formula, or indicator placement can transform a slow day into a memorable one. This article explains the core nymphing techniques every angler should know, when each approach works best, and how to choose tools and tactics that match the water in front of you.

A useful starting definition is this: effective nymphing is controlled dead drift, or near dead drift, delivered at the right depth with immediate strike awareness. Everything else supports those goals. Some methods use a strike indicator for visibility, some rely on direct contact through tight-line systems, and others suspend flies beneath larger dry flies. Regardless of style, the fundamentals remain stable: read the seam, estimate feeding depth, use enough weight to reach that zone, control slack, and adjust constantly. Once you grasp those principles, the many branches of nymphing become easier to understand and far easier to fish well.

Understanding how fish feed on nymphs

Trout do not feed randomly underwater. They position where current delivers food efficiently while conserving energy, usually near seams, cushion water in front of rocks, drop-offs, ledges, undercut banks, and transition lanes where fast and slow currents meet. In pocket water, fish often sit only inches from the bottom behind a rock, rising a short distance to intercept drifting nymphs. In long runs, they may line up along a depth contour where current speed and oxygen levels are ideal. On tailwaters, selective trout can hold in soft slots and feed on tiny midges or sowbugs all day. Understanding those feeding positions is the basis of all successful nymphing techniques.

Most natural nymphs drift close to the streambed during much of their life cycle, which is why anglers hear the phrase “if you’re not occasionally ticking bottom, you’re probably not deep enough.” That statement is broadly true, though not absolute. During active migration or emergence, insects may rise through the column, and fish may suspend to intercept them. Caddis pupae, for example, often ascend quickly, and trout respond with more aggressive takes than they show on drifting mayfly nymphs. Stonefly nymphs tend to stay deeper and move near banks before hatching. When I approach a new river, I start by asking a simple question: are fish feeding on bottom-oriented drift, ascending insects, or a mixture of both? The answer dictates the rig and presentation.

Water temperature, flow level, light intensity, and angling pressure all shape feeding behavior. In cold water, trout often narrow their feeding window and hold in slower water where they can eat without burning energy. In higher flows, fish slide to edges, softer shelves, and inside seams while still taking nymphs aggressively. In clear, low summer water, they may inspect flies more closely, making fine tippet and natural drifts more important. These conditions explain why no single nymphing method wins everywhere. The best anglers are not loyal to one setup; they are loyal to solving the feeding problem fish present on a given day.

Core nymphing techniques and when to use them

Indicator nymphing is the most accessible and versatile approach. A buoyant indicator suspends one or more flies and signals depth and strikes. This method shines in medium to large rivers, deeper runs, mixed current speeds, and situations where longer drag-free drifts matter more than direct contact. It is especially effective for beginners because the visual cue helps with timing, but experts use it too because it covers water efficiently. The key is setting the indicator at roughly one and a half to two times the water depth as a starting point, then adjusting until the flies drift naturally near the bottom without hanging up constantly.

Tight-line nymphing, including modern European styles, removes or minimizes the indicator and uses a long leader, thin line, and direct connection to the flies. This system excels in pocket water, short to medium ranges, and complex currents where floating line creates drag. By leading the flies with the rod tip and maintaining controlled contact, the angler feels or sees takes through a colored sighter. In my experience, this approach often outperforms indicator rigs in broken water because it reaches depth quickly and reduces slack. Its limitation is range: once fish are far away or currents become too broad, maintaining clean contact becomes harder.

Dry-dropper fishing combines a buoyant dry fly with a nymph suspended below it. On riffles, banks, and summer trout water, it is an efficient searching system because it can catch fish on either fly while keeping the presentation relatively light. It is not ideal for the deepest winter slots, but it is superb for covering moderate-depth water where trout may eat nymphs below and opportunistically rise to a terrestrial or attractor dry. High-stick nymphing, a close-range method often used before it had a fashionable label, remains one of the deadliest forms of presentation in pocket water. The angler keeps most line off the water, tracks the drift with the rod tip, and controls depth with split shot or bead-head flies.

Technique Best water type Main strength Primary limitation
Indicator nymphing Runs, seams, deeper drifts, larger rivers Long natural drift with clear strike detection More surface drag in complex currents
Tight-line nymphing Pocket water, riffles, short to medium range Fast sink rate and direct contact Less effective at long range
Dry-dropper Shallow to medium riffles, banks, summer water Covers two feeding levels at once Limited depth and weight capacity
High-stick nymphing Close pocket water and broken current Excellent drift control Requires close approach

Choosing among these nymphing techniques starts with current complexity, target depth, and distance to the fish. If the run is ten feet deep and forty feet away, an indicator rig usually gives the cleanest drift. If the water is three feet deep with fast chop and boulders, a tight-line or high-stick approach often gives better control. If trout are opportunistic and the water is moderate, a dry-dropper can search quickly and fish pleasantly. Successful anglers switch systems without ego. Matching method to water is one of the clearest separating lines between average nymph fishers and consistently productive ones.

Building an effective rig: rod, leader, weight, flies, and tippet

Nymph rigs work when their components support the intended presentation. For general trout fishing, a 9-foot 5-weight rod remains the all-around standard, but many dedicated nymph anglers prefer rods from 10 to 11 feet in 2- to 4-weight configurations for better reach, line control, and strike detection. Longer rods mend line more easily on indicator setups and extend contact in tight-line presentations. Reels matter less than rods, though a smooth drag helps on larger rivers. Floating line is standard for indicator and dry-dropper fishing, while specialized thin euro lines or mono rigs are common in tight-line systems.

Leader construction is where many drifts are won or lost. An indicator setup may use a 9-foot tapered leader extended with fluorocarbon tippet and enough distance from indicator to flies to achieve depth. Tight-line leaders are more specialized, often built from a butt section, transition material, a brightly colored sighter, and fine tippet to the point fly. Thinner diameter cuts through water faster, allowing nymphs to sink sooner. Fluorocarbon is popular because it is denser than nylon and generally more abrasion resistant, though nylon remains useful when extra suppleness or float characteristics are preferred above the terminal section.

Weight is not an accessory; it is depth control. Tungsten beads sink faster than brass and have changed modern nymphing dramatically. Split shot still has an important role, especially when you need to adjust depth quickly without changing flies. As a rule, place enough weight to reach the feeding lane early in the drift, but not so much that the flies plow unnaturally. Two-fly rigs are common because the heavier point fly helps anchor depth while a lighter dropper offers a second food signal. Productive patterns include pheasant tails, hare’s ears, perdigons, zebra midges, caddis pupae, stonefly nymphs, and regional staples like scuds or sowbugs where those foods dominate. Match size before exact color, and match behavior before exact appearance.

Presentation, strike detection, and drift control

The best nymph pattern fails if the drift is wrong. Presentation begins before the cast with approach angle and target selection. Enter the water quietly, avoid throwing your shadow across the seam, and start close before working farther out. Cast slightly upstream or upstream-across often enough to allow sink time, then immediately manage slack. On indicator rigs, mend early and sparingly to align line with current lanes. On tight-line rigs, lead the flies with the rod tip at the same pace as the current, staying connected without dragging them. The ideal drift looks unforced because the flies move at the speed of the water surrounding them.

Strike detection separates capable nymph anglers from exceptional ones because many takes are nearly invisible. With an indicator, any hesitation, dip, sideways slide, or unnatural stall deserves a hook set. With tight-line methods, watch the sighter for twitches, straightening, or subtle acceleration; at the same time, stay alert for faint taps transmitted through the rod. Set on anything suspicious. Trout reject artificial nymphs quickly, and hesitation costs fish. A short, efficient lift of the rod usually suffices. Massive hook sets create tangles, move flies out of the zone, and break fine tippet.

Drift control also means controlling the end of the drift. Many fish eat as flies begin to rise at the end, imitating emerging insects. Allowing a slight lift can be deadly with caddis pupae and soft hackles. Conversely, in a classic dead-drift scenario, too much swing creates drag and pulls flies out of the feeding lane. Good nymphing therefore involves constant micro-decisions: add weight, move the indicator, shorten the cast, change angle, alter fly spacing, or switch from bottom-oriented nymphs to emergers. I routinely tell clients that nymphing is not passive fishing. It is active problem solving measured in inches and seconds.

Reading water, adapting to conditions, and avoiding common mistakes

Reading water well lets you fish the highest-percentage lies first. In riffles, focus on slots with broken surface texture that gives trout cover. In runs, prioritize seams, depth changes, and current tongues that funnel food. In pocket water, target the soft cushions in front of rocks, the darker slots behind them, and any short foam line that marks converging currents. On stiller spring creeks, fish often hold where weed beds create lanes, and precise casts with smaller nymphs become essential. During runoff or after rain, the edges can be far better than the middle because trout avoid the heaviest current while continuing to feed.

Common mistakes repeat across skill levels. The biggest is fishing too shallow. The second is too much slack, which delays strike detection and prevents proper sink. The third is using one approach all day despite clear evidence it is not working. Other errors include casting too far, wading through good holding water, refusing to rotate fly size, and failing to observe natural insects under rocks or in the drift. A simple seine or quick look at streamside shucks can reveal whether size 18 baetis, caddis pupae, or larger stoneflies should guide your choices. That observation is often more valuable than changing colors repeatedly.

Seasonal adaptation is equally important. Winter nymphing usually favors slower water, smaller flies, and precise drifts near the bottom. Spring can bring both heavy flows and major hatches, rewarding stonefly nymphs, worms, and then mayfly imitations as water stabilizes. Summer often opens the door to dry-dropper rigs, lighter weight, and opportunistic fish in riffles. Fall can combine aggressive feeding with low clear conditions, so stealth and tippet management matter. If you want to improve quickly, keep notes on river level, temperature, rig, fly size, and productive water type. Patterns emerge fast, and those records turn isolated good days into a repeatable system.

Nymph fishing rewards anglers who treat the underwater drift as a craft rather than a guess. The central lesson is simple: fish where trout actually feed, get the flies to that level quickly, and maintain enough control to detect and answer every credible take. Whether you prefer indicator nymphing on broad runs, tight-line systems in pocket water, high-stick drifts at close range, or a dry-dropper for versatile summer searching, the winning principles are depth, contact, and natural movement. Tackle choices, leader formulas, and fly patterns matter, but they serve presentation rather than replace it.

As a hub within techniques and strategies, nymphing connects directly to deeper subjects such as strike indicator selection, euro leader design, seasonal trout behavior, fly weighting, reading seams, and matching subsurface insects. Build your skill methodically. Practice one variable at a time: first depth, then slack control, then strike detection, then water reading. You will catch more fish, lose fewer drifts, and understand rivers at a much higher level. Frequently Asked Questions

What is nymph fishing, and why is it so effective for trout and grayling?

Nymph fishing is a fly-fishing technique focused on imitating the underwater life stage of aquatic insects such as mayflies, caddisflies, and stoneflies. Because these insects spend the majority of their lives below the surface, trout, grayling, and many other river fish feed on them far more consistently than they feed on adult insects drifting on top. That is the core reason nymphing is so productive: it matches what fish are eating most often, not just what looks exciting to anglers.

What makes nymph fishing especially effective is that it targets fish at their feeding level. Instead of waiting for surface rises, the angler presents a fly close to the riverbed, in the current seam, or through the deeper lanes where fish hold and intercept drifting food. In many rivers, especially during cold weather, high pressure, or periods of sparse hatch activity, fish may rarely break the surface at all. In those conditions, nymphing can dramatically outperform dry-fly fishing simply because it puts the fly where the fish already are.

It is also a technique built around precision. Good nymph anglers pay attention to depth, drift speed, line control, and strike detection. Fish often take a nymph very subtly, so success depends on presenting the fly naturally and recognizing minute signals before the fish spits it out. That technical side is part of the appeal. Nymphing is not just productive; it is an active, skill-based style of fishing that rewards observation, adjustment, and refined control.

What are the most important techniques for successful nymph fishing?

The most important principle in nymph fishing is achieving a natural drift. Your fly should move at the same speed as the current around it, without drag caused by the fly line or leader pulling unnaturally. If the nymph races ahead, swings too early, or lifts out of the zone, fish are less likely to commit. A natural drift is often more important than the exact fly pattern, which is why line management and positioning are foundational skills.

Depth control is equally critical. Most feeding fish hold near the bottom because that is where many nymphs drift before emerging, and because current is slower and safer there. If your fly is too shallow, fish may never see it. If it is too deep, you may snag constantly and lose efficiency. Successful anglers learn to adjust split shot, tungsten bead size, leader length, and indicator placement to keep the fly ticking close to the strike zone without dragging unnaturally along the bottom. Occasional bottom contact is usually a good sign that you are fishing deep enough.

Strike detection is another major element. Takes on nymphs are often subtle and fast. Sometimes the indicator only hesitates for an instant, the sighter twitches, or the leader simply stops drifting naturally. Anglers who wait for obvious strikes miss fish. A good habit is to treat any unusual movement as a possible take and set the hook immediately with a controlled lift. In modern tight-line methods, maintaining direct contact with the flies improves sensitivity and helps anglers detect light takes that would go unnoticed under an indicator.

Finally, approach and angle matter. Casting upstream, up-and-across, or short-range across likely holding water allows the fly to sink quickly and drift naturally through productive lanes. Wading too aggressively or casting from poor positions can put fish down and reduce drift quality. The best nymph fishers break the river into manageable pieces, identify seams, pockets, drop-offs, and riffle transitions, then fish each section methodically.

How do I choose the right nymph setup, including rod, leader, flies, and strike detection system?

A balanced nymph setup starts with a rod suited to the type of water and the style of nymphing you plan to use. For all-around river nymphing, a 9-foot 4- or 5-weight rod is a common choice because it offers good casting ability, line control, and fish-fighting performance. If you are focusing heavily on tight-line or European-style nymphing, a longer rod in the 10- to 11-foot range, often in 2- to 4-weight, provides better reach, improved contact, and finer strike detection. The longer rod helps keep more line off the water and allows for more precise drifts in complex currents.

Leader design depends on the technique. Traditional indicator nymphing usually uses a tapered leader with added tippet, plus enough distance between the indicator and the flies to reach the desired depth. Tight-line systems often use a specialized long leader built around a thin butt section, a highly visible sighter, and fine tippet to maximize sensitivity and reduce sag. In either case, the goal is to present the nymph naturally while preserving as much control and strike detection as possible.

Fly selection should reflect both realism and practicality. Productive nymph boxes usually include mayfly nymphs, pheasant tails, hare’s ears, caddis larvae, stonefly nymphs, and attractor patterns with tungsten beads for depth. In many situations, size and sink rate matter more than exact imitation. If fish are not responding, adjust weight, profile, and size before obsessing over tiny color differences. Carry a range of patterns in different weights so you can adapt to shallow riffles, deep runs, and faster currents.

For strike detection, anglers typically choose between indicators and direct-contact systems. A strike indicator is excellent for beginners and for fishing deeper water because it offers a clear visual cue and helps suspend the flies at a set level. Tight-line systems, on the other hand, provide more immediate contact and often better sensitivity at shorter range. Neither approach is universally better; each has strengths. The best setup is the one that matches the water, your skill level, and your ability to maintain a clean, controlled drift.

Where should I fish a nymph, and how do I identify the best holding water?

The best nymph water is usually where fish can hold comfortably while food drifts to them with minimal effort. In rivers, that often means current seams, riffle tails, pocket water, slots between rocks, the heads of runs, and the softer water along depth changes. Trout and grayling are energy-efficient feeders. They prefer places where the current brings insects while still allowing them to avoid fighting heavy flow all day. If you can identify those feeding lanes, you can place your nymph where fish are most likely to intercept it.

Riffles are often highly productive because they oxygenate the water and dislodge insects from the riverbed. The transition where a riffle slows into a run is especially valuable, as fish can station themselves just off the main current and pick off drifting nymphs. Pocket water is another prime target because fish use rocks and broken current for cover. In these areas, short, controlled drifts are usually more effective than long casts, since the fish may be holding in very specific micro-lanes only a few feet apart.

Depth changes are key visual clues. A dark trough, a bubble line, an undercut bank, or a soft edge beside fast water can all indicate feeding lies. Grayling often favor steady current with access to the bottom, while trout may hold tighter to cover, structure, or softer slots. Seasonal conditions also influence location. In cold water, fish may hold deeper and feed less aggressively, making slower drifts near the bottom essential. During higher flows, fish often slide into softer margins, side channels, or inside bends where they can feed without expending too much energy.

One of the most effective habits is to fish likely water systematically. Start close, cover near seams and slots first, then work farther out. Change angle, depth, or weight before abandoning a run. Many anglers leave fish behind because they cast too far too soon or fail to drift the fly through the exact lane where fish are holding. Reading water well is one of the defining skills in nymph fishing, and it improves with careful observation and deliberate practice.

What are the most common mistakes in nymph fishing, and how can I fix them?

The most common mistake is fishing too shallow. Many anglers underestimate how quickly current lifts a fly and how close to the bottom fish often feed. If your nymph is not getting down, you are simply drifting over the fish. The fix is straightforward: add weight, lengthen the leader, move the indicator higher, or choose a heavier fly. If you are occasionally touching bottom without snagging constantly, you are usually in a much better zone than if you never make contact at all.

Another major mistake is poor line control. Excess slack, conflicting currents, and mending too late can all ruin the drift. A nymph that drags unnaturally is often ignored, even if it is the right pattern and depth. To fix this, shorten your casting distance, improve your angle, and focus on leading the drift with the rod tip rather than simply watching the fly line float away. In many situations, less casting and more control leads to more fish.
